Output 58dd1d15dcf1f0ecb7ba9424f7fe2f5510674c92d4a1ed417c8cfd2cfcc08080:0

value
2093400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40a438ec14c77fc396e10a0c847497a337d409d OP_EQUAL
address
3NUnHRqwHWdeTVD18Vr8GU2dZe77jn1kcY
transaction
58dd1d15dcf1f0ecb7ba9424f7fe2f5510674c92d4a1ed417c8cfd2cfcc08080
confirmations
136421
spent
true